> >      unable to open display ""
> 
> This one is because they have to "talk" to the right X server, so they
> need the DISPLAY env variable set, to know which one.
> 
> On your (probably) single machine with (probably) just one X server
> and one display, try prefixing the command with a var setting like
> so:
> 
>   DISPLAY=:0 <my command with args>

(of course, this will only work if there /is/ an X server running
in the first place :)
